Output 161faea6258a28e2c7505039b05e06cefe0964772f6f26477cd2b2b2bfdfef99:2

value
107999934
script pubkey
OP_0 OP_PUSHBYTES_20 9bcc4edfc69089d8dfca304ffb495ac731c9b816
address
ltc1qn0xyah7xjzya3h72xp8lkj26cucunwqk5864lz
transaction
161faea6258a28e2c7505039b05e06cefe0964772f6f26477cd2b2b2bfdfef99
spent
true